Fortinet FortiGate Platform Wins Gold and Silver Awards at This Year's 10th Annual Info Security Products Guide Global Excellence Awards

SUNNYVALE, CA -- (Marketwired) -- 03/07/14 -- Fortinet® (NASDAQ: FTNT) -- a world leader in high-performance network security -- today announced that the company's FortiGate®-140D-POE and FortiGate-240D were awarded Gold and Silver awards respectively in the categories of UTM and Firewall at this year's 10th annual Info Security Products Guide Global Excellence Awards. These prestigious global awards recognize security and IT vendors with advanced, ground-breaking products and solutions that are helping set the bar higher for others in all areas of security.

More than 50 judges from a broad spectrum of industry voices from around the world participated, and their average scores determined the 2014 Global Excellence Awards Finalists and Winners. Winners were announced during the awards dinner and presentation on February 24, 2014 in San Francisco attended by the finalists, judges and industry peers.

About the FortiGate-140D-POE and FortiGate-240D
The FortiGate-140D-POE and FortiGate-240D were part of the major expansion to the FortiGate UTM product line the company introduced in July 2013 for SMBs, retail networks, healthcare, and branch/home offices. Both the FortiGate-140D and 240D series offer extremely high port densities, enabling customers to simplify their network by eliminating switches. Customers can connect wireless access points, IP-based technologies such as VoIP phones, point of sale terminals, medical devices and other devices directly to the FortiGate for improved security and visibility.

The FortiGate-200D series provides a mid-range network security platform designed for branch offices and SMB customers and delivers up to 84 Gigabit Ethernet (GbE) ports and up to 4 Gbps firewall throughput and 1 Gbps of IPSec VPN performance.

The FortiGate-140D series features up to 42 GbE ports and up to 2.5 Gbps firewall throughput at 450 Mbps of IPSec VPN performance.
